US Pressure on Enron Denounced

The United States government is determined to protect the interests of Enron, the American multinational corporation, whatever be the costs the people of Maharashtra and India have to pay. This is the message which was delivered by Christina Rocca during her visit to India. Speaking about the Dabhol power company, which is charging exorbitant rates for electricity, she has emphasised, "that it will be difficult for international investors to view India favourably until it is resolved, and in a reasonable manner". The threat implied is obvious.

In the past few weeks, whenever Indian government representatives have met members of the Bush administration, including the Vice-President, Dick Cheney, the American side has demanded that the Dabhol power company dispute be resolved in favour of Enron. This reflects the well-known close links the Republican administration, starting with President Bush, has with the Enron corporation.

As far as India is concerned, the Maharashtra state government has been forced to order a judicial enquiry into the Dabhol agreement. The Enron project at Dabhol is a standing testimony to how powerful multinational corporations suborn governments to sign illegal and unequal agreements. The Vajpayee government, which is responsible for providing the counter-guarantee to this project, must not give in to such blatant pressure.
The Polit Bureau of the CPI(M) demands that the Central government and the state government stand firm and state that the terms of the agreement of the Dabhol power project cannot be implemented
